How do I create a RAID 1 Dell?

Select Create RAID Volume and press ENTER. Enter a RAID volume name or accept the default and press ENTER. For RAID 0, select RAID 0 (Stripe) and press ENTER or for RAID 1 select RAID 1 (Mirror) and press ENTER. Select the two drives that will constitute the RAID configuration and press ENTER.

Should I set up RAID 1?

RAID 1 is not a backup, and is never, ever a replacement for a good backup. Always remember that RAID 1 is a hedge against hardware failures, not malware or corrupted data. If you get a virus on one drive in a RAID 1 array, every drive in the array will have the virus written to it.

How do I access Dell RAID controller?

When these systems are configured in UEFI BIOS mode, the RAID setup is accessed from the F12 pre-boot menu. Press F12 on power up while at the Dell logo splash screen. Then, select “Device Configuration” from the list shown in the F12 pre-boot menu.

How do I set up raid on my Dell laptop?

Enter System Setup. (Tap the F2 key at the Dell logo) Press the up- and down-arrow keys or use the mouse to highlight Drives. Press . < ENTER > Press the up- and down-arrow keys or use the mouse to highlight SATA Operation. Press . < ENTER > Press the mouse to select the RAID On radio button. Click Apply.

What kind of RAID controller does Dell Precision use?

This article talks about the Dell Precision Workstation systems and setting up RAID using the RAID controller cards. Dell Precision workstations offer several options for hard drive controllers: Both the H310 and H710P cards offer multiple 6 Gb/s ports for SATA, SAS, or SSD drives and support for RAID 0, 1, 5, and 10 configurations.
